Let’s be clear from the start: the distress many trans people experience is not because of who they are, but because of the world they live in. Much of what is labelled as “mental illness” in the trans community is in fact a natural response to ongoing abuse, marginalisation, and systemic violence. From micro-aggressions to harmful legislation, from misgendering in public spaces to the denial of basic healthcare—trans people are forced to navigate a world that relentlessly questions and attacking their existence.
